وب سایت تخصصی شرکت فرین
دسته بندی دوره ها

Build Ecommerce REST API with Django REST Framework & Python

سرفصل های دوره

Build E-commerce REST API in Django & Django REST Framework with Postgres, Stripe, AWS, JWT, Deployment on AWS & more


1 - Introduction
  • 1 - Introduction to the Course
  • 2 - What is API REST API
  • 3 - What is Django Django REST Framework

  • 2 - Setting Up Environment
  • 4 - Install all required tools

  • 3 - Source Code
  • 5 - Source Code of Project

  • 4 - Lets Start Ecommerce API
  • 6 - Create new project Understating Folder Structure
  • 7 - Setting Up Django REST Framework Config file
  • 8 - Connect to Postgres Database
  • 9 - Product App Model
  • 10 - Create new Product from Django Admin Panel
  • 11 - Get all Products Products Serializer
  • 12 - Get Products Details

  • 5 - Filters Search Pagination
  • 13 - Add Filters
  • 14 - Adding Product Search
  • 15 - Add Pagination to Products API

  • 6 - ErrorException Handling
  • 16 - Handle 404 500 Errors
  • 17 - Custom Exception Handling

  • 7 - Upload Product Images Manage Product
  • 18 - Create AWS S3 Bucket IAM User
  • 19 - AWS Configuration Images Model
  • 20 - Upload Multiple Product Images to AWS S3
  • 21 - DisplayList Images in Product
  • 22 - Create new Product through Endpoint
  • 23 - Adding Product Validations
  • 24 - Update Product Details
  • 25 - Delete Product
  • 26 - Delete Images on Product Deletion with Signals

  • 8 - Authentication
  • 27 - Auth App JWT Configuration
  • 28 - Sign Up User Serializer
  • 29 - Register User
  • 30 - Login User
  • 31 - Get Current User
  • 32 - Save User while Creating Product
  • 33 - Update User Profile

  • 9 - Manage Product Reviews
  • 34 - Review Model Serializer
  • 35 - CreateUpdate Review
  • 36 - Display all reviews in product
  • 37 - Delete Review

  • 10 - Forgot Reset Password
  • 38 - Mailtrap Email Configurations
  • 39 - Forgot Password UserProfile
  • 40 - Reset Password

  • 11 - Manage Order Resource
  • 41 - Order App Order Model
  • 42 - Order Item Model
  • 43 - Order OrderItems Serializers
  • 44 - Create new Order Endpoint
  • 45 - Get All Orders Single Order
  • 46 - Apply Pagination Filters on Orders
  • 47 - Process Order Delete Order
  • 48 - Admin Only Endpoints

  • 12 - Integrate Stripe for Payments
  • 49 - What is Stripe Setting up Stripe
  • 50 - Stripe checkout Session Endpoint
  • 51 - What is Stripe Webhook Setting up webhook for development
  • 52 - Stripe Webhook endpoint
  • 53 - Create Order on Payment Success

  • 13 - Deploy API
  • 54 - Preparing API for Deploy
  • 55 - Deploy API

  • 14 - End of the Course
  • 56 - Congratulations
  • 139,000 تومان
    بیش از یک محصول به صورت دانلودی میخواهید؟ محصول را به سبد خرید اضافه کنید.
    افزودن به سبد خرید
    خرید دانلودی فوری

    در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.

    ایمیل شما:
    تولید کننده:
    مدرس:
    شناسه: 8769
    حجم: 2561 مگابایت
    مدت زمان: 372 دقیقه
    تاریخ انتشار: ۱۰ فروردین ۱۴۰۲
    طراحی سایت و خدمات سئو

    139,000 تومان
    افزودن به سبد خرید